When recruiting automation tools run multiple searches simultaneously or sequentially, the same candidate profile can surface across several queries. How a platform resolves those duplicates determines whether your shortlist contains the best matches or simply the most frequently appearing ones. Deduplication logic is not a background housekeeping task: it is a core quality control layer that directly shapes who you interview.

Why Do Duplicate Candidates Appear in AI Recruiting Searches?
Duplicate candidates are an expected byproduct of scale, not a sign of a broken system. When recruiting automation tools scan LinkedIn, GitHub, job boards, and niche communities simultaneously [gem.com], the same individual can appear through multiple discovery paths: a keyword search on one channel, a Boolean query on another, and a saved search from a previous role on a third.
Several structural causes make duplication almost inevitable:
- Overlapping search parameters. A search for “Python engineer with fintech experience” and “backend developer with payments background” can return the same candidates under different query logic.
- Repeated sourcing cycles. Always-on platforms re-index talent pools over time, meaning a candidate surfaced in January can reappear in a March refresh of the same search.
- Multi-role campaigns. Companies hiring for a senior engineer and a tech lead simultaneously may have significant overlap in the candidate universe that qualifies for both.
- Cross-channel identity fragmentation. The same person may have a LinkedIn profile, a GitHub account, and a listing in a niche community with slightly different names, job titles, or email addresses, making automated matching harder.
The challenge is not that duplicates exist. It is whether the platform resolves them intelligently before the shortlist reaches you.
What Is Deduplication Logic and How Does It Work in AI Recruiting?
Deduplication logic is the set of rules and matching algorithms a platform uses to identify when two or more candidate records refer to the same person and decide what to do with that information. Platforms handle this in meaningfully different ways, and the approach matters more than most buyers realise [canditech.io].
At the most basic level, some tools do exact-match deduplication: if two records share the same email address, one is discarded. This works for clean, complete data but fails the moment a candidate uses different email addresses on different platforms, which is common.
More sophisticated approaches layer in:
| Deduplication Method | How It Works | Limitation |
|---|---|---|
| Exact email match | Flags identical email addresses | Fails across platforms with different accounts |
| Name plus employer fuzzy match | Matches on similar name and overlapping work history | Can create false positives for common names |
| Profile vector similarity | Compares embedded representations of full profiles | Computationally intensive; requires strong ML infrastructure |
| Cross-source identity resolution | Links records across channels using multiple signals | Requires deep integration across sourcing channels |
The gap between the first and last row in that table represents the difference between a platform that occasionally misses duplicates and one that systematically resolves identity across a fragmented talent landscape [recruiterflow.com].
How Does Duplicate Handling Affect Shortlist Quality?
Building on the deduplication mechanics above, the harder question is what actually goes wrong when a platform gets this wrong. Poor duplicate handling produces three specific shortlist quality problems.
1. Score inflation for frequently-appearing candidates. If a candidate surfaces across six searches and each instance accumulates engagement signals (views, clicks, partial outreach), a naive scoring model may interpret that activity as evidence of high fit. The candidate ranks highly not because they are the best match, but because they appeared most often. This is a measurement artefact, not a quality signal [pmc.ncbi.nlm.nih.gov].
2. Shortlist dilution. If three of your ten shortlisted candidates are the same person under slightly different records, you have effectively received eight unique candidates, not ten. Hiring managers often catch this after the fact, which erodes trust in the platform.
3. Suppression of genuinely strong candidates. When a strong candidate is deduplicated out of a search because they were already “seen” in a previous role campaign (where they were not selected for reasons unrelated to their quality), they may never resurface. Without a merge-and-retain logic that preserves the candidate across contexts, the system discards a strong match unnecessarily.
Cleaner, smaller shortlists of genuinely distinct candidates tend to help hiring teams make stronger decisions than shortlists inflated with hidden duplication [ibm.com].
What Should a Well-Designed Deduplication System Actually Do?
A related but distinct question is what good looks like in practice. Strong deduplication systems share several characteristics:
- Merge, do not delete. Rather than discarding duplicate records, merge them into a single enriched profile that combines data from all sources. A candidate’s GitHub activity and LinkedIn headline should live in one unified view.
- Preserve search context. The merged record should retain which search queries or role campaigns discovered the candidate, so ranking can be evaluated within the right context.
- Apply role-level suppression intelligently. A candidate who was shortlisted and declined for a junior role should not be auto-suppressed when they become relevant for a senior role two years later. Suppression rules need expiry logic.
- Surface deduplication decisions to human reviewers. Platforms that combine AI sourcing with human expert review [heymilo.ai] can catch false merges (two people with similar profiles who are genuinely different individuals) before they distort the shortlist.
The last point is particularly important. Deduplication that relies solely on algorithm can miss edge cases where matching rules produce confident but incorrect results. Human review acts as a quality gate.
Frequently Asked Questions
What is deduplication in recruiting software?
Deduplication is the process of identifying and consolidating candidate records that refer to the same person across multiple data sources or searches.
Does deduplication only matter for large candidate databases?
No. Even a single multi-channel search can surface the same candidate through different pathways, making deduplication relevant at any volume.
Can poor deduplication logic introduce bias?
Yes. If frequently-appearing candidates score higher due to repeated exposure rather than genuine fit, the system favours visibility over quality [pmc.ncbi.nlm.nih.gov].
How do AI recruiting tools identify the same person across platforms?
Advanced tools use a combination of email matching, name-employer fuzzy matching, and profile-level similarity scoring to resolve identity across fragmented sources [recruiterflow.com].
What is the difference between suppression and deduplication?
Deduplication consolidates records that are the same person. Suppression is a separate decision about whether to exclude a known candidate from a specific search based on prior interaction.
Should candidates who declined previous outreach be permanently suppressed?
Not automatically. Role context, timing, and the reason for non-response all matter. Good platforms apply time-bound suppression rules rather than permanent exclusions.
How does human review improve deduplication accuracy?
Human reviewers catch false merges (two different people incorrectly combined) and false separations (one person incorrectly split across records), which purely algorithmic systems handle inconsistently [cohesyve.com].
